An ex-Army staffer, featured by Politico, faced indictment on Wednesday for allegedly disclosing classified information to a journalist.
Courtney Williams, 40, possessed a top-secret security clearance while employed at a “special military unit” stationed at Fort Bragg, North Carolina, from 2010 to 2016, as detailed in the indictment.
She allegedly maintained communication with journalist and author Seth Harp through phone calls and text messages from 2022 to 2025. During these interactions, Williams reportedly conveyed “classified national defense information,” which Harp later included in a book and a magazine article published by Politico.
Harp cited Williams directly in his August 2025 exposé, which investigated claims of sexual misconduct and drug trafficking within the Army’s elite Delta Force.
